What is the role of durability in building facade design?

Durability is a critical factor in building facade design as it ensures that the facade components can withstand wear and tear over time. The facade is the first line of defense against harsh weather conditions such as wind, rain, and sun, and it must be designed with long-lasting materials and robust construction techniques to withstand these elements.

In addition to protecting the building from the outside elements, durability is also important for maintaining the aesthetic appeal of the facade. As the facade is the most visible part of the building, it must look attractive and maintain its appearance despite exposure to the outside environment.

Durability in facade design can also help reduce maintenance costs and improve energy efficiency. A highly durable facade will require less frequent repairs and maintenance, which will save money in the long run. Furthermore, durable materials such as high-performance glass or thermal insulation can help reduce energy consumption and improve the building's overall energy efficiency.

Overall, durability is an essential factor in building facade design as it ensures the longevity, aesthetic appeal, and energy efficiency of the building, and reduces maintenance costs over time.
